<title>ANTI DERMATOPHYTIC ACTIVITY OF AZADIRACHTA INDICA AND ACALYPHA INDICA LEAVES- AN IN VITRO STUDY </title>
<abstract>This study was conducted to evaluate the effect of ethanolic, ethyl acetate and hexane extracts of Indian medicinal plants  lessThan i greaterThan Azadirachta indica  lessThan /i greaterThan and  lessThan i greaterThan Acalypha indica lessThan /i greaterThan  leaves against dermatophytes (60 isolates of  lessThan i greaterThan Trichophyton rubrum lessThan /i greaterThan , 22 isolates of  lessThan i greaterThan Trichophyton mentagrophytes, lessThan /i greaterThan  9 isolates of  lessThan i greaterThan Microsporum gypseum lessThan /i greaterThan  and 9 isolates of  lessThan i greaterThan Trichophyton tonsurans) lessThan /i greaterThan . Of the three extracts used the ethanolic and ethyl acetate extracts were equally good in inhibiting all the isolates. The extracts of  lessThan i greaterThan Azadirachta indica lessThan /i greaterThan  leaves showed antifungal activity with an MIC and MFC ranging from 125µg to 500µg. On the contrary,  lessThan i greaterThan Acalypa indica lessThan /i greaterThan  leaf extracts showed less activity with a MIC ranging from 500µg to 1000µg against all the dermatophytes tested. The minimum activity was seen with hexane at a conc of 250µg/ml for  lessThan i greaterThan Azadirachta indica lessThan /i greaterThan  and at a concentration of 500µg/ml for  lessThan i greaterThan Acalypha indica. lessThan /i greaterThan </abstract>
